Benefits Of Swimming For Seniors

swimmming

One of the most beneficial exercises for people of all ages is none other than swimming. Swimming is a timeless and effective way to stay fit and reap numerous health benefits for seniors. Swimming is not only soothing and serene but can also help seniors to age gracefully. 

It is the most recommended activity for seniors to maintain their physical, mental as well and emotional well-being. Here are some benefits of swimming outlined below. 

Benefits Of Swimming 

Low impact exercise 

Seniors’ joints become susceptible to wear and tear as they age. So seniors with joint problems can opt for swimming because the water supports the body weight and reduces the risk of injuries or joint problems. 

Improves sleep quality 

There are plenty of seniors who struggle with insomnia in old age. Fortunately, seniors can improve their sleep quality by reducing anxiety and promoting relaxation. Getting a good night’s sleep is essential for seniors for their overall health and well-being. 

Flexibility 

Another benefit of swimming is that it promotes flexibility in seniors. There is a wide range of motions and stretches that promote flexibility in seniors. Practicing swimming every day can make everyday activities easier and less painful for seniors. The flexibility in seniors also goes a long way in reducing the risk of falls and injuries. 

Manages weight 

Swimming is a beneficial exercise for older adults to manage their weight, burn calories, and increase metabolism, which is essential for maintaining a healthy body composition as they age.

Sharpes mind 

Swimming also makes seniors mentally sharp as it requires seniors to focus, concentrate, and coordinate. Consequently, swimming regularly tends to reduce cognitive decline and prevent conditions like dementia among seniors. 

Combats loneliness 

Participating in community swim classes or visiting local pools allows seniors to engage in social interaction, which can help alleviate feelings of isolation and loneliness. These activities offer a platform for seniors to meet and connect with others, promoting mental and emotional health through shared interests.

Good heart health 

Besides the above-mentioned benefits, swimming also improves the senior’s heart health and leads to lower blood pressure, improved circulation, and reduced risk of heart disease. It strengthens the heart muscles and improves overall cardiovascular fitness.
